简介:电脑图标ICO格式是一种专为计算机操作系统设计的图像文件格式,它支持多种尺寸和颜色模式的图像,确保在各种显示器分辨率下清晰显示。本指南将深入探讨ICO格式的设计基础、应用实例、编辑与管理方法,以及在UI设计中的重要性,旨在帮助用户提升软件界面的用户体验、品牌识别度及整体美观。
1. ICO格式的设计基础与适应性
在讨论ICO格式的设计基础与适应性之前,我们需要了解ICO文件格式本身。ICO文件是由多个图标数据组成的容器,每个图标数据可以包含不同尺寸和颜色模式的图像,从而为不同操作系统环境提供支持。这种设计使得ICO文件不仅可以用于表示应用程序图标,还可以用于书签、桌面快捷方式等场景。
ICO格式的一个核心优势是它的适应性。它能够自适应不同的显示环境,无论是高分辨率的现代显示器,还是旧式低分辨率屏幕, ICO图标都能保持清晰。这种自适应特性得益于ICO格式支持多种尺寸的设计。设计师可以根据需求制作出16x16到256x256甚至更高分辨率的图标版本,覆盖绝大多数应用场景。
设计适应性的图标还意味着需要考虑不同操作系统的视觉需求。例如,在Windows系统中,ico图标不仅需要美观,还要有良好的用户体验,包括在高DPI设置下仍能保持清晰度。适应性还体现在颜色模式上,ICO支持包括256色和True Color在内的多种颜色模式,为设计师提供了极大的灵活性。接下来的章节中,我们将详细探讨如何设计不同尺寸和颜色模式的ICO图标。
2. ICO图标支持的多种尺寸和颜色模式
2.1 不同尺寸的ICO图标设计要点
2.1.1 常见的图标尺寸及其用途
图标是用户与操作系统及应用程序交互的桥梁,它们的尺寸必须适应不同的显示环境和使用场景。在Windows系统中,ICO文件支持多种尺寸,常见的尺寸包括16x16、32x32、48x48、64x64、128x128等像素尺寸。每种尺寸的图标都有其特定的应用场合:
- 16x16像素图标 :主要用于文件资源管理器中,作为列表视图的图标显示,或在控制面板、对话框等界面中作为小程序的图标。
- 32x32像素图标 :用于桌面图标,同时在开始菜单、工具栏、任务栏等界面作为默认大小显示。
- 48x48像素图标 :通常用作“缩略图”模式下的显示,例如,当用户通过视图选项设置查看文件夹内容时。
- 64x64像素图标及以上 :常用于高DPI显示器或在应用程序的“属性”页面、安装程序中作为详细视图模式的图标显示。
在设计时,需要考虑图标在不同尺寸下依然能保持良好的可视性和辨识度。图标设计者应该着重于图标的主要视觉元素,确保即使在缩小的情况下,这些元素仍能被用户轻易识别。
2.1.2 如何设计适配不同分辨率的图标
为了适应屏幕分辨率的多样性,图标设计师需要在不同的尺寸下测试图标的设计,以确保在各种显示环境下都能达到最佳的视觉效果。这里有一些设计适配不同分辨率图标的技巧:
- 简化图标细节 :随着图标尺寸的缩小,过于复杂的设计会使得图标失去辨识度。设计师应减少不必要的细节,保留图标的核心特征。
- 清晰的边缘 :保持图标边缘的清晰度和锐利度,有助于在缩小尺寸时保持图标的可辨识性。
- 使用矢量图形 :矢量图形可以在任何尺寸下无损放大或缩小,非常适合图标设计。使用矢量图形工具(如Adobe Illustrator或Inkscape)可以方便地生成不同尺寸的图标。
- 测试在多种设备上的显示效果 :在不同分辨率的显示器上测试图标的显示效果,确保在不同设备上都具有良好的适应性和用户体验。
在设计流程中,设计师应该使用专业的图标设计软件,并利用它们提供的预览功能,实时查看不同尺寸下的图标效果。此外,获取用户反馈也是一个重要环节,通过用户的实际使用情况来调整和优化图标设计。
2.2 颜色模式对ICO图标的影响
2.2.1 常用的颜色模式介绍
在设计ICO图标时,颜色模式的选择也至关重要,因为不同的颜色模式对图标的视觉表现和文件大小都有影响。最常用的两种颜色模式是:
- RGB颜色模式 :红色、绿色和蓝色(Red, Green, Blue)是光的三原色,RGB模式是一种加色模式,用于电子显示设备上。RGB模式下的每个颜色通道都可以从0到255变化,因此它可以表示大约1670万种颜色。
- 图标颜色深度 :图标支持的颜色深度(位深)通常有256色(8位)、16色(4位)、真彩色(24位)等。颜色深度越高,所支持的颜色就越丰富,图标就越能呈现出更多的细节和渐变效果,但相对应的文件大小也会增加。
选择适当的颜色模式和颜色深度对于创建高质量的图标非常重要,因为图标设计需要在视觉效果和文件大小之间取得平衡。
2.2.2 颜色深度在图标设计中的重要性
颜色深度决定了图标可以使用的颜色数量,它直接影响图标的视觉效果和适用场景。了解不同颜色深度下的图标应用是至关重要的:
- 256色(8位) :虽然可选颜色较少,但这种颜色深度的图标文件体积小,加载速度快,适用于对性能要求较高的环境。8位图标在早期计算机和低分辨率的设备上非常常见。
- 16色(4位) :比256色的图标更小,但在现代计算机和设备上,16色的图标可能会显得粗糙和不实用。
- 真彩色(24位) :允许使用超过1600万种颜色,为图标提供了极大的色彩表现力。真彩色图标在高分辨率和高DPI显示器上表现最佳,适用于对颜色要求较高的应用和游戏图标。
在设计过程中,图标设计师应该根据图标最终应用的环境和预期效果来选择合适颜色深度。例如,对于大多数桌面应用程序和网站图标,建议使用真彩色图标,以获得最佳的视觉体验。
图标设计中的颜色模式和颜色深度选择,不仅关系到图标的最终显示效果,还影响用户的体验和操作系统的性能。因此,在设计图标时,设计师需要权衡色彩表现与图标大小,确保图标在各种设备和显示环境中的兼容性和美观性。
3. ICO图标的透明性特点
透明性是ICO图标的一个显著特点,它使得图标能够在不同的背景上无痕迹地融合,提升了界面的整体美感和用户体验。本章将深入探讨透明ICO图标的制作方法、应用优势以及透明度与用户界面的融合。
3.1 透明ICO图标的制作与应用
3.1.1 透明图标的制作技巧
透明ICO图标通常使用PNG格式作为源文件,然后通过图标编辑器转换为ICO格式。在制作透明ICO图标时,应注意以下几点:
- 源文件准备 :使用支持透明度的图像编辑软件(如Adobe Photoshop)创建PNG源文件,确保图标的透明背景是按照Alpha通道来处理的。
- 图像编辑 :在图像编辑软件中,可以利用图层的透明度设置或通道编辑功能来实现部分透明效果。
- 保存为PNG :保存文件时应保持透明信息,确保在转换过程中透明度不受影响。
- 转换为ICO :使用支持透明度转换的ICO编辑工具(例如Axialis IconWorkshop、GIMP等),导入PNG文件后,选择适当的参数进行转换。这些参数通常包括图标大小和颜色深度。
下面是一个简单的代码示例,展示了如何使用Python的Pillow库将PNG图像转换为ICO格式:
from PIL import Image
import os
# 打开PNG图像文件
png_image = Image.open("transparent_icon.png")
# 转换图像尺寸为所需的ICO尺寸,例如32x32
ico_image = png_image.resize((32, 32), Image.ANTIALIAS)
# 定义输出文件路径
output_path = "transparent_icon.ico"
# 保存为ICO格式
ico_image.save(output_path)
print(f"ICO file saved to {output_path}")
在这个例子中,我们使用了Pillow库,它是Python的一个图像处理库,可以用来导入、修改和保存图像文件。请注意,直接保存为ICO格式可能不会保留透明度信息,因此可能需要使用专门的库或工具来处理透明度。
3.1.2 透明图标在不同场景下的优势
透明图标的优势在于其灵活性和适应性。它们能够在多种背景下自然地显示,无论是在深色背景还是浅色背景上,透明图标都能够让用户界面显得更加和谐。在Web设计、应用程序以及操作系统的用户界面中,透明图标为设计师提供了更多自由发挥的空间。
例如,在网页设计中,透明图标可以放置在不同的背景图片之上,不会因为背景色的改变而显得突兀。在操作系统中,图标设计得更加灵活,可以很容易地适应不同的主题和样式。
3.2 透明度与用户界面的融合
透明度不仅仅是一个技术特性,它还是用户界面设计中的一个重要元素,对用户体验有深远的影响。
3.2.1 透明度对于用户体验的影响
在用户界面中,图标往往是最直观的交互元素。透明度能够使图标在视觉上与背景和其他界面元素融合,避免视觉冲突,降低视觉疲劳。用户在浏览界面时,不易被突兀的图标所分散注意力,从而获得更为沉浸的体验。
3.2.2 如何优化图标透明度以提升界面美观性
为了最大化透明图标的优势,设计师需要考虑以下几点:
- 对比度 :确保图标内容和背景之间的对比度,这样即使在透明度较高的情况下,图标信息也能够清晰传达。
- 边框处理 :在某些情况下,轻微增加图标边缘的描边可以增加可读性。
- 测试不同背景 :在多种背景上测试图标的效果,确保它们在所有情况下都能够良好地融合。
- 用户反馈 :积极收集用户反馈,了解图标透明度对用户体验的影响,根据反馈进行调整。
透明度的应用和优化是一个不断迭代和改进的过程,需要设计师具备敏锐的视觉感知力和对用户体验的深刻理解。通过上述的方法,设计师可以在不同场景下更好地应用透明ICO图标,从而提高界面的美观性和用户体验。
4. ICO图标在操作系统中的应用
图标作为图形用户界面(GUI)的基本元素,其在操作系统中的应用显得尤为重要。从桌面图标到系统设置,甚至是应用程序和浏览器书签,ICO图标都扮演着至关重要的角色。在本章中,我们将深入探讨ICO图标在操作系统中的具体应用,并讨论如何通过个性化定制和优化来提升用户体验和品牌识别度。
4.1 桌面图标与系统设置中的ICO应用
4.1.1 桌面图标的个性化定制
桌面图标是用户与操作系统交互的第一触点,它们的视觉效果直接影响到用户的使用体验。通过个性化定制桌面图标,用户不仅可以根据自己的喜好来打造独一无二的桌面环境,还能提高工作效率。例如,使用特定的图标集来快速区分不同功能的应用程序和文件。
桌面图标个性化定制的关键在于图标的多样性和一致性。操作系统的默认图标往往不能满足所有用户的需求,因此,个性化定制通常包括更改图标主题、调整图标大小和更换图标形状等。例如,在Windows操作系统中,用户可以通过第三方图标包来替换默认图标,通过设置软件来调整图标大小和样式。
代码示例:使用PowerShell批量更换Windows图标
以下是一个PowerShell脚本示例,展示如何批量更换Windows 10系统中的桌面图标。这个脚本会更改默认的文件夹图标到一个指定的ICO文件。
# PowerShell脚本批量更换桌面图标
# 首先,指定新的图标文件路径
$NewIconPath = 'C:\path\to\your\new\icon.ico'
# 然后,获取所有默认的桌面图标并更换
Get-ChildItem 'HKCU:\Software\Microsoft\Windows\CurrentVersion\Explorer\ControlPanel\NameSpace' | ForEach-Object {
# 更换默认的桌面图标
Set-ItemProperty -Path $_.PsPath -Name '(Default)' -Value 'Folder'
Set-ItemProperty -Path $_.PsPath -Name 'DefaultIcon' -Value "$NewIconPath,0"
}
此脚本中,我们使用了PowerShell的 Get-ChildItem
命令来遍历注册表中的特定路径,该路径下存储了桌面图标的配置信息。 Set-ItemProperty
命令用于更改这些图标对应的默认图标文件。请注意,运行此脚本需要管理员权限,并在执行前确保已经备份好相应的注册表项。
4.1.2 系统设置中图标的统一性与美观性
在系统设置中,图标不仅仅是视觉元素,更是用户与操作系统沟通的桥梁。图标的一致性和美观性对于系统的整体感观和用户的使用感受有着重要影响。用户在设置界面中通过图标来识别各项功能,如果图标风格统一且易于理解,可以大大降低用户的认知负担。
为此,许多现代操作系统提供了官方的图标主题和方案,以确保系统内图标的一致性。在一些自定义选项中,操作系统的设置菜单允许用户调整图标大小,甚至在一些高级主题中,用户还可以更改图标的形状和颜色。
在美观性方面,随着操作系统的不断更新,其图标设计越来越追求简洁、清晰和现代化。例如,微软的 Fluent Design 系统在图标设计上使用了丰富的色彩和半透明效果,提供了更为动态和层次感的视觉体验。
接下来,我们将探讨如何将浏览器书签图标和应用程序图标融入到用户体验中,以及这些图标如何增强品牌识别度。
5. 创建和编辑ICO图标的专业工具及图像转换方法
创建和编辑ICO图标是设计过程中不可或缺的一环。随着计算机技术的发展,设计师有更多专业工具可供选择来制作符合要求的图标,同时也需要掌握如何将各种图像格式转换为ICO格式的技术。
5.1 专业工具在图标设计中的作用
在图标设计中,使用专业工具可以帮助设计师提高工作效率和图标质量。
5.1.1 常见的图标编辑软件功能对比
- Adobe Illustrator :矢量图形编辑软件,支持无限放大缩小不失真。适合设计矢量图标,并可以导出为不同尺寸的位图图标。
- Sketch :专为UI/UX设计而生,含有丰富的图标库和易于使用的矢量绘图工具。可轻松导出多种格式和尺寸的图标。
- Iconion :一款图标生成和编辑工具,可以将现有图片转换成图标,同时支持图标的各种颜色和风格的调整。
在选择合适的图标编辑软件时,需要考虑项目的具体需求,如是否需要矢量绘图、批量处理图标以及是否支持其他设计协作功能。
5.1.2 工具选择对图标质量的影响
不同工具的设计理念和技术实现直接影响到最终图标的质量。
- 矢量编辑工具 :如Adobe Illustrator,可以制作高精度的矢量图标,有利于保持图标在不同平台上的清晰度和一致性。
- 位图编辑工具 :如Adobe Photoshop,适合进行像素级别的细节处理,适用于设计那些需要更复杂细节处理的图标。
- 专用图标设计工具 :如Iconion,提供了一键生成和样式调整功能,便于快速制作具有统一风格的图标集。
选择正确的工具能够有效提高设计效率,保证图标设计的专业性和高质量输出。
5.2 图像格式转换为ICO的方法
将其他格式的图像转换为ICO格式是图标设计和开发过程中常见的需求。
5.2.1 不同图像格式转换为ICO的技巧
- PNG和JPEG格式转换 :这两种格式是常见的图像格式,可以通过在线工具或者专业软件轻松转换为ICO格式。通常需要选择合适的尺寸和颜色深度来优化图标效果。
- SVG格式转换 :SVG格式是基于矢量的图形格式,它可以在不失真的情况下被无限放大缩小。在转换SVG到ICO时,需确认软件支持矢量到位图的转换,并注意对矢量路径的处理,避免转换后图标出现不必要的模糊。
5.2.2 转换工具的选择和操作流程
-
在线转换工具 :如FreeConvert或Zamzar,这类工具使用简单,无需下载安装,适合少量的转换任务。上传图片,选择输出为ICO格式,然后下载转换后的图标即可。
-
专业软件 :如Axure RP或XnConvert。这类软件支持批量转换,并提供了丰富的转换设置,适合需要高效处理大量图标的设计项目。操作流程一般是:添加图片文件 -> 设置输出参数(尺寸、颜色模式等) -> 执行转换任务。
选择合适的转换工具和遵循正确操作流程可以显著提升工作效率,并确保输出的图标满足项目需求。
实际操作示例
以下是使用XnConvert批量将PNG格式图像转换为ICO格式的详细步骤:
- 下载并安装XnConvert工具。
- 打开XnConvert,点击“添加文件”按钮,批量选择需要转换的PNG文件。
- 在输出设置中选择保存路径、格式为ICO,并设置所需的图标尺寸和颜色深度。
- 点击“转换”按钮开始批量转换。
通过这些详细的操作步骤,用户可以方便地将各种格式的图像转换为ICO图标,满足不同的应用场景需求。
简介:电脑图标ICO格式是一种专为计算机操作系统设计的图像文件格式,它支持多种尺寸和颜色模式的图像,确保在各种显示器分辨率下清晰显示。本指南将深入探讨ICO格式的设计基础、应用实例、编辑与管理方法,以及在UI设计中的重要性,旨在帮助用户提升软件界面的用户体验、品牌识别度及整体美观。